#137410 basic color information

#137410

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#137410 has decimal index of: 1274896, is composed of 7.5% red, 45.5% green and 6.3% blue. #137410 in CMYK color model, is composed of 83.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.2% yellow and 54.5% black.
#006600 is the closest web-safe color to #137410.
